The Fundamentals of Fowl Forward Motion
At its core, the gameplay of a “chicken crossing the road” style game revolves around precise timing and a keen awareness of the surrounding environment. The player’s primary goal is to advance the chicken across the road, earning points with each successful step forward. However, the path is fraught with peril, in the form of relentlessly approaching vehicles. A collision with a car results in game over, requiring the player to start anew. The speed of the vehicles generally increases as the player progresses, ramping up the difficulty and demanding quicker reflexes. Successfully navigating the road requires anticipation – predicting the trajectories of the cars and identifying safe windows for movement. Mastering this requires a deep understanding of the game mechanics and a healthy dose of practice.
Beyond simply avoiding collisions, many versions of the game incorporate scoring systems that reward risk-taking and skillful maneuvering. For instance, players may earn bonus points for moving quickly, for dodging multiple vehicles in succession, or for achieving specific milestones. These scoring mechanics add an extra layer of depth to the gameplay, encouraging players to push their limits and strive for higher scores. The game’s interface is typically minimalistic, emphasizing the core gameplay loop. Clear visuals and intuitive controls are crucial to ensure a seamless and enjoyable experience. The focus remains firmly on the action unfolding on the screen, allowing players to fully immerse themselves in the challenge.
Optimizing Your Chicken’s Journey
To maximize your score and achieve consistent success, several strategies can be employed. Firstly, observation is crucial. Spend a few moments studying the traffic patterns before making your first move. Identify gaps in the flow of vehicles and plan your movements accordingly. Secondly, don't be afraid to wait. Sometimes, the safest course of action is to pause and allow a vehicle to pass before proceeding. Impatience often leads to costly mistakes. Thirdly, practice makes perfect. The more you play, the better you'll become at anticipating the movements of the cars and timing your actions. Consistent play will hone your reflexes and improve your overall awareness.
Finally, consider the rhythm of the game. Many iterations have a subtle but noticeable cadence to the traffic flow. By learning to recognize this rhythm, you can predict when safe opportunities will arise. Utilizing power-ups, if available, can also provide a temporary advantage. Power-ups might include temporary invincibility, speed boosts, or the ability to slow down time. Knowing when and how to use these power-ups effectively can be a game-changer.

Strategies for Mastering the Road: Advanced Techniques
Once you’ve grasped the basic principles of avoiding traffic, you can begin to explore more advanced techniques to truly maximize your score and longevity in the game. One key strategy is to anticipate the acceleration of vehicles. Often, cars will subtly speed up as they approach the chicken’s position. Learning to recognize these changes in speed is crucial for timing your movements effectively. Another important tactic is to utilize the edges of the screen as visual cues. Paying attention to the appearance of vehicles on the periphery allows you to prepare for their arrival and plan your next move accordingly. Don’t solely focus on the cars directly in front of the chicken; maintain a broad awareness of the surrounding traffic.
Beyond reactive adjustments, consider adopting a more proactive approach. Instead of simply reacting to oncoming cars, try to predict their movements based on their speed and trajectory. This requires a degree of spatial reasoning and the ability to visualize the unfolding traffic flow. Furthermore, many versions of the game feature varying lane speeds. Identifying the faster and slower lanes and strategically utilizing them can provide a significant advantage. Lastly, don’t be afraid to experiment with different movement patterns. Sometimes, a slightly unconventional path can be more effective than a straight line across the road.
